Вопросы с тегом «notnull»

264
MySQL SELECT только ненулевые значения

Можно ли сделать оператор выбора, который принимает только значения NOT NULL? Прямо сейчас я использую это: SELECT * FROM table И тогда я должен отфильтровать нулевые значения с помощью цикла php. Есть ли способ сделать: SELECT * (that are NOT NULL) FROM table ? Прямо сейчас, когда я выбираю *, я...

183
Как проверить, является ли текстовый столбец SQL Server пустым?

Я использую SQL Server 2005. У меня есть таблица с текстовым столбцом, и у меня есть много строк в таблице, где значение этого столбца не нулевое, но оно пустое. Попытка сравнить с '' дает следующий ответ: Типы данных text и varchar несовместимы в операторе не равно. Существует ли специальная...

147
Почему компилятор C # переводит это сравнение =, как если бы это было сравнение?

Я случайно обнаружил, что компилятор C # превращает этот метод: static bool IsNotNull(object obj) { return obj != null; } ... в этот CIL : .method private hidebysig static bool IsNotNull(object obj) cil managed { ldarg.0 // obj ldnull cgt.un ret } ... или, если вы предпочитаете смотреть на...

131
Ruby on Rails: как добавить ограничение, отличное от NULL, в существующий столбец с помощью миграции?

В моем приложении Rails (3.2) у меня есть куча таблиц в моей базе данных, но я забыл добавить несколько ненулевых ограничений. Я искал в Google, но я не могу найти, как написать миграцию, которая добавляет ненулевое значение в существующий столбец....

86
Определение столбца SQL: значение по умолчанию, а не избыточное значение NULL?

Я много раз видел следующий синтаксис, который определяет столбец в операторе создания / изменения DDL: ALTER TABLE tbl ADD COLUMN col VARCHAR(20) NOT NULL DEFAULT "MyDefault" Возникает вопрос: поскольку указано значение по умолчанию, необходимо ли также указывать, что столбец не должен принимать...